## Onboarding: Load Testing the Checkout Flow

Welcome to the Cartholme platform team. Load tests against the checkout flow run nightly via the Stresslark harness, targeting the staging cluster only — never production. Scenarios cover cart creation, payment authorization, and receipt generation at 500 requests per second. Results land in the perf dashboard each morning. To run the harness locally, you'll need cluster access, which requires registering a deploy key with the staging gateway. Use the key below.

rollout seal: bky9_PeXH1fTLY

Handover note — Quillcast template rendering

Taking over from me on Quillcast perf work. Summary: render latency was dominated by cold template compilation, so we added a warm cache and capped concurrent renders. P95 is now under 180ms on the Dorval cluster. Don't raise the concurrency cap without re-running the memory soak test. Everything else is documented in the runbook. The settings currently deployed are as follows.

service settings:
HOLIX_HOST=holix.qorvelsys.internal
HOLIX_PORT=7000

Subject: Intern cohort arriving Monday

Hi all,

The front desk here at Torval Dynamics will be hosting the summer intern cohort from 9am on Monday. Expect around fifteen people gathering in the Fenwick lobby; they'll be signed in as a group and taken to Orientation Room 2. New starters helping with the welcome should arrive by 8:45 and wear lanyards so interns can spot you. The orientation room stays locked outside sessions, so you'll need the door code below.

staff pass of fadug-kajog = bdg-HL-4

# Brindle Service Environments

As of this quarter, the homegrown job queue ("Stacker") has been replaced by Quillfeed in all environments. Staging cut over first; production followed two weeks later. On-call: alerts referencing Stacker are stale and can be closed. Quillfeed workers scale automatically in production. The staging environment currently runs with the following configuration values:

service settings:
[casax]
port = 6379
team = rusir
host = casax.zemvarhq.corp
region = outer-4
access_code = ac_9808ce
timeout_ms = 1500